Eagle Peaks Mining LLC <br />Bullger Basin Placer <br />Park County <br />M-1985-022 <br />Eagle Peaks Mining would like to make the following revisions to their mining plan: <br />1. We would like to sell screened/processed material from our plant to help offset the costs of <br />mining. This would be gravel/roadbase and rock. <br />2. We would like to move one of our existing lower settling ponds to a higher area, remaining in <br />the permitted area. Please see the attached illustration. We have discussed this with the local <br />water commissioner and it was approved. The pond will be constructed so that it consumes the <br />same surface area as the existing pond, which will be reclaimed. The pond will be constructed in <br />an area that is already disturbed so no new disturbed area is required. <br />3. Eagle Peaks Mining would like to construct a new access road to the plant site from the pond <br />area. The proposed road will be entirely in the permitted area and make access to the plant and <br />pit area more convenient. The existing road is quite steep and is used by other land/claim <br />owners. The proposed road will be have a lesser grade for safer and private access by Eagle <br />Peaks Mining. Please see illustration. The new road will be in a previously disturbed area, <br />requiring no new disturbance. <br />
